This Notice provides information about what Firefox Voice collects and how we might share it.

Information we collect

Voice recordings

To process and carry out your command, a recording of your command and a transcript of your recording are created. Once the command is completed, we immediately delete the recording and transcription, unless you allow Mozilla to store them.

To help us improve Firefox Voice, you may choose to allow Mozilla to store your voice commands and transcripts of your commands. We store this data without personally identifiable information, which means we don’t know who said them.

Interaction data

Mozilla receives technical data from Firefox Voice related to performance of the feature, such as browser type and time needed to process submitted recordings.

Technical data

Mozilla receives metrics information including the number of voice samples recorded, session length and outcome, results provided by Firefox Voice, and whether those results are modified or selected.
